For a hotel which aims to provide a 5* experience (as per their website), they need to drastically improve their aim! Recently stayed for one night in what was described as a "Deluxe double" room. We arrived around 4.30, and were booked in efficiently, then personally taken to our room by the duty manager Leane. We unpacked our bag, quickly got changed and left to have an evening in Stirling. On our return and having more time to look closely at the room, we discovered no soap in either of the soap dispensers, a cracked window, window frames with flaking paint and black mould, windows were dirty. There was black mould on the back of all curtains. The theme continued in the bathroom. One window was screwed shut because the catch was missing, the roller blind didn't work, the toilet flush was loose and the cistern cracked. The wash basin was cracked, the chain on the plug was broken off. The plastic bath panel was cracked on the edge. There was black mould on the baseboard of the shower. Back in the bedroom, the old fashioned wooden floor standing clothes hanger was unusable as the top was broken, there was a sizeable chunk of wood missing on the bedframe, and when we turned on the centre light the amount of dust and cobwebs on the fitting was shocking. One of the bulbs wasn't working. The duty manager Leane was called, and she agreed that the room fell well below the standard, but the hotel was full so she couldn't move us. She said the owner was in the hotel and she would get him to come and see the room....he didn't bother. It was too late to start looking for another hotel, so we had to stay the night. The next morning, the new duty manager (Maggie) advised us the bill had been reduced from £99 to £49. After the delicious breakfast, we advised her we were not willing to pay for the room, but would pay £25 for the breakfast. She rang the owner who just said "OK, that's fine" This hotel needs a disgusting amount of money spent on it to bring it up to an acceptable standard, and its clear the current owner has no interest in doing it. I feel for his staff, who are doing a great job and deserve a medal in my opinion......he's lucky to have them.

With a stay at OYO Dunmar House Hotel in Alloa, you'll be within a 15-minute drive of Stirling Castle and Alloa Tower. This hotel is 2.5 mi (4.1 km) from Alloa Golf Club and 3.3 mi (5.2 km) from Gartmorn Dam Country Park.

Take in the views from a terrace and a garden and make use of amenities such as complimentary wireless internet access. Additional amenities at this hotel include a picnic area and a banquet hall.

For lunch or dinner, stop by Dunmar House Hotel and R, a bar/lounge that specializes in British cuisine. Dining is also available at the coffee shop/cafe, and room service (during limited hours) is provided. A complimentary full breakfast is served daily from 6:30 AM to 9:30 AM.

Featured amenities include a 24-hour front desk and luggage storage. Free self parking is available onsite.

Treat yourself to a stay in one of the 9 guestrooms, featuring fireplaces and flat-screen televisions. Complimentary wireless internet access keeps you connected, and digital programming is available for your entertainment. Conveniences include desks and electric kettles, and housekeeping is provided daily.
